Thousands sample food at Alcester

Redditch Editorial 24th Oct, 2014 Updated: 18th Oct, 2016   0

THOUSANDS of visitors descended on Alcester as part of its Autumn food festival.

About 18,000 people pounded the pavements of the High Street and its surrounding roads on Saturday (October 18).

More than 100 stalls lined the streets selling everything from gourmet coffee to freshly baked bread, while healthy cooking lessons were also on offer in the Town Hall.

Coffee@26 on the High Street also played host to the Great Cake Off, sponsored by the Redditch and Alcester Standard, which saw 12 bakers cooking up their best winter fruit cake for a panel of judges.




The winner was Margaret Moore, a member of Great Alne and Kinwarton WI, with her ginger and apple cake. In second place was ten-year-old Charlie Gwillym, and third place went to Mandy Jones.
